4 hours ago, lairdo said:

And so, seeing the back of the Deluxe CD edition (thank you for the photo), it appears that the discs on both CD versions are in fact the same (and presumably the CDs within the CD+BR edition) with the introductions as bonus tracks.

 

So, unlike with the Live in Vienna version, only the video version interleaves the JW introductions with the music. Interesting.

 

The CDs have the same running order as the concert video with introductions between pieces. It's just the digital release that has the applause and introductions edited out.

I attended the concert and I just listened to the recording. That recording is… interesting. It's nothing like the live performance (at least that's my feeling). The mix is really weird with a front facing piano or harp that you can awkwardly hear well. All and All I really like the recording though. Because it makes it different and I can spot new parts of pieces I thought I knew by heart :)
